Back to Home

Toolhouse - Deploy Advanced AI Tools in One Click

Toolhouse offers a comprehensive cloud infrastructure to deploy efficient actions and knowledge for AI applications, saving developers weeks of development time with just 3 lines of code. Explore our low-latency cloud, universal SDK, and app store for AI tools.

image: Toolhouse - Deploy Advanced AI Tools in One Click

Featured

The Toolhouse Cloud

The Toolhouse Cloud is designed to enhance LLM performance through high-quality, low-latency infrastructure. Key features include performance optimization, secure data storage, and comprehensive observability. The cloud infrastructure caches and optimizes tool responses, reducing costs and simplifying management. It also ensures secure data retrieval and storage, and provides detailed insights into LLM inputs and tool responses.

Frequently Asked Questions

The FAQ section addresses common queries about the Toolhouse platform. It covers topics such as supported programming languages, pricing models, tool safety, and data privacy. This section helps users understand the capabilities and benefits of Toolhouse, ensuring they have the information needed to make informed decisions.

What is Toolhouse?

Toolhouse is a 1-click platform that facilitates the deployment of efficient actions and knowledge for AI applications. It provides a low-latency cloud infrastructure that optimizes inference times, reduces token usage, and serves tools at the edge for optimal performance. Additionally, it includes an App Store for tool use, allowing developers to install various tools in their LLMs with minimal effort.

Universal SDK

The Toolhouse Universal SDK is a powerful tool that simplifies the integration of AI functionalities into applications. It requires only 3 lines of code and is compatible with all major LLMs and frameworks. The SDK supports flexible response handling, including plain responses and streaming, and works seamlessly across different environments. It also helps reduce hallucinations by grouping the right tools for specific tasks.

The Tool Store

The Tool Store is a unique feature of Toolhouse that allows developers to install tools in their LLMs as easily as installing apps on a smartphone. It offers a range of production-ready functions, such as accessing the internet, executing code, performing RAG, and semantic search. Each tool is optimized for performance and security, and the Tool Store includes built-in evaluation to ensure consistent quality. Developers can integrate multiple tools quickly and efficiently using the SDK and Tool Bundles.

Definition of Toolhouse as a 1-click platform

Toolhouse is a cutting-edge platform designed to simplify the deployment of advanced AI solutions with just one click. It eliminates the complexities associated with traditional AI deployment methods, making it accessible to developers of all skill levels. Whether you're a seasoned professional or a beginner, Toolhouse provides an intuitive interface that streamlines the process of integrating sophisticated AI capabilities into your projects.

Key features: low-latency cloud, App Store for tool use, and universal SDK

One of the standout features of Toolhouse is its low-latency cloud infrastructure, which ensures that AI models run smoothly and efficiently, providing real-time responses without any lag. Additionally, the platform includes an extensive App Store where users can discover and integrate a wide range of pre-built tools and applications, further accelerating development cycles. To support seamless integration, Toolhouse offers a universal SDK that works across multiple platforms and programming languages, making it easy to incorporate AI functionalities into existing systems.

Benefits: reduced development time, optimized performance, and cost savings

Using Toolhouse, developers can significantly reduce the time and effort required to deploy AI solutions. The platform's streamlined workflow and pre-built tools minimize the need for custom coding, allowing teams to focus on innovation rather than infrastructure. Moreover, the optimized performance of the low-latency cloud ensures that applications run efficiently, enhancing user experience. Finally, by leveraging Toolhouse's cost-effective solutions, businesses can achieve significant savings on both development and operational expenses, making AI deployment more accessible and affordable.

High-quality, Low-latency Infrastructure

At Toolhouse Cloud, we pride ourselves on delivering high-quality, low-latency infrastructure that ensures your applications run smoothly and efficiently. Our state-of-the-art data centers and optimized network architecture minimize latency, providing fast and reliable access to your AI tools and services. Whether you're deploying machine learning models or running complex data processing tasks, our infrastructure is designed to handle the demands of modern AI workloads.

Performance Optimization: Caching and Optimizing Tool Responses

To ensure optimal performance, Toolhouse Cloud employs advanced caching mechanisms and response optimization techniques. By caching frequently accessed data and optimizing the way tool responses are handled, we significantly reduce load times and improve the overall user experience. This means your applications can respond quickly to user requests, even under heavy loads, ensuring a seamless and efficient operation.

Secure Data Storage and Retrieval

Security is a top priority at Toolhouse Cloud. We provide robust and secure data storage solutions that protect your valuable information from unauthorized access, data breaches, and other security threats. Our data encryption methods and secure retrieval protocols ensure that your data remains confidential and intact. With Toolhouse Cloud, you can trust that your data is stored safely and can be retrieved quickly when needed.

Comprehensive Observability: Tracking LLM Inputs and Tool Responses

Understanding how your AI models and tools perform is crucial for continuous improvement. Toolhouse Cloud offers comprehensive observability features that allow you to track inputs to large language models (LLMs) and monitor tool responses in real-time. This detailed insight helps you identify bottlenecks, optimize performance, and ensure that your AI applications are functioning as intended. With our observability tools, you can gain a deeper understanding of your AI workflows and make data-driven decisions to enhance your applications.

3 Lines of Code for Integration

At Toolhouse, we pride ourselves on making the integration process as seamless as possible. With our Universal SDK, you can deploy advanced AI capabilities with just three lines of code. This simplicity ensures that developers of all skill levels can quickly and easily incorporate powerful AI functionalities into their projects without the need for extensive coding knowledge.

Compatibility with Major LLMs and Frameworks

Our Universal SDK is designed to work seamlessly with a wide range of leading language models (LLMs) and frameworks. Whether you're using TensorFlow, PyTorch, or any other popular AI framework, our SDK ensures compatibility and smooth integration. This flexibility allows you to leverage the best tools available in the market, ensuring that your AI applications are always at the cutting edge of technology.

Flexible Response Handling: Plain Responses and Streaming

One of the key features of our Universal SDK is its ability to handle responses in multiple formats. Developers can choose between plain text responses for straightforward interactions or streaming responses for more dynamic and real-time applications. This flexibility ensures that you can tailor the user experience to meet the specific needs of your project, whether it's a chatbot, a virtual assistant, or any other AI-driven application.

Reducing Hallucinations by Grouping Appropriate Tools

Hallucinations, or the generation of inaccurate or irrelevant content, can be a significant issue in AI applications. Our Universal SDK addresses this challenge by intelligently grouping appropriate tools and models. This approach helps to reduce the likelihood of hallucinations, ensuring that the AI-generated content is accurate, relevant, and reliable. By leveraging these grouped tools, developers can build more trustworthy and effective AI solutions.

Supported Programming Languages

At Toolhouse, we understand the importance of flexibility and accessibility in AI deployment. Initially, our platform supports Python, one of the most widely used programming languages in the data science and machine learning communities. This choice ensures that developers and data scientists can leverage their existing skills and integrate seamlessly with popular libraries and frameworks. Whether you're building a simple script or a complex AI model, Python on Toolhouse provides the robustness and versatility you need to deploy your projects with ease.

Pricing Model Details

Transparency and fairness are core values at Toolhouse. Our pricing model is designed to cater to both startups and large enterprises. We offer a free tier that includes basic features and limited API calls, perfect for testing and small-scale projects. For more extensive use, we provide scalable paid plans that grow with your needs. Each plan offers a detailed breakdown of costs, including compute resources, storage, and support options. Our goal is to make AI accessible without breaking the bank, ensuring that every user can find a plan that fits their budget and requirements.

Safety and Security of Tools in the Tool Store

At Toolhouse, the safety and security of our users' data and applications are paramount. All tools available in our Tool Store undergo rigorous vetting and security audits to ensure they meet the highest standards. We implement multi-layered security protocols, including encryption, access controls, and regular vulnerability assessments. Additionally, we maintain strict compliance with industry regulations and best practices to protect your data and intellectual property. You can trust that when you use tools from the Tool Store, you are working with reliable and secure solutions.

Data Privacy and Handling

Respecting and protecting user data privacy is a cornerstone of our mission at Toolhouse. We adhere to stringent data protection policies and comply with global data privacy laws, such as GDPR and CCPA. Your data is encrypted both in transit and at rest, and we provide granular control over who can access it. We also offer transparent data handling practices, allowing you to manage and delete your data as needed. By choosing Toolhouse, you can deploy AI with confidence, knowing that your data is safe and your privacy is respected.